Below are 5 steps for getting yourself back on course when you’re feeling lost:
  1. Notice. Notice when your head takes you into overwhelm and keeps you spinning in fear, worry and doubt. Your stressing, worrying and feeling lost are clues you are in your head and are going in the wrong direction. Notice, acknowledge the impact it’s having on your well-being and forgive yourself.
  1. Feel into your body. Take a deep breathe. Drop out of your head and into your body. How do you feel? Most likely you feel tight, constricted and heavy. Your body is letting you know you are off track. Your body is your compass.
  1. Get curious.  Ask yourself, “What happened? What doesn’t feel right?” Writing in a journal, talking to someone you trust or getting out in nature can help. Ask, “If I had a chance to this all over again, what would I do differently? What have I learned? What is this teaching me about myself and others?”
  1. Replace fear with trust. Remember, you have not lost your way. Trust in the process. Trust nothing is happening to you…instead, everything is happening for you…to learn and grow, to course-correct and move forward again. This is all part of life. You are on your journey! Remember, this too shall pass.  This is part of being human. This is part of the journey of your lifetime. As humans, this is how we evolve and grow.
  1. Take action. Ask, what is the next right move? Instead of allowing your small mind to take you into overwhelm and feel stuck, stop. Take a deep breath, come into your body, quiet your mind and ask, “What is my next right move in this moment?” Then, do that. And, ask again, “What is my next right move in this moment?” and do that. Take baby steps in the present moment. This will take you back in right direction.

Remember to feel into each choice. If it feels right, do that. If it feels wrong, stop and get curious.

Your life is much bigger than that one stressful moment of overwhelm. Everything is happening for a reason….either to propel you toward your Soul’s purpose or to show you when you’re off track. Use the steps above and trust in the process of life.
